Job Description - Telehandler/Zoom Boom Operator (2215)

Company Description:



Launched in 1998 with nothing more than a used Caterpillar dozer and an entrepreneurial spirit, Bouchier has grown to be a leading provider of integrated site services to the Athabasca Oil Sands region.



From our head office in Fort McKay, Alberta, the company now employs more than 1200 dedicated team members and commands a fleet of over 425 pieces of equipment. 



With a strong belief in doing the right things in the right way, Bouchier is now one of the largest companies owned and operated by Indigenous peoples in the area providing contracting, construction, and general site services.

Role Summary: 



The Telehandler/Zoom Boom Operator is responsible for operating designated equipment in a safe and appropriate manner. The Operator must also clean, maintain and secure all equipment as directed by legislation, as well as company policies and procedures.



Primary Responsibilities: 




  • Operate all assigned equipment in a safe and effective manner

  • Read, countersign, and enter comments into daily operator logbook



  • Must comply with work order system to include interpreting work orders, performing work requested and completing work orders per instruction.



  • Complete and document a pre-operational check on assigned equipment

  • Grease equipment as necessary

  • Ensure equipment has proper safety equipment in place

  • Keep interior and exterior as clean as possible

  • Must have the ability to work well independently while maintaining a high level of safety, respect and great communication skills



  • Loads or unloads material for a variety of departments, companies or business units as dispatched or called over radio.



  • Any required repairs to assigned equipment are communicated to maintenance personnel

  • Maintain a cooperative working relationship with clients and other employees

  • Participate in Job Hazard Assessments, Field Level Risk Assessments, and tool box meetings

  • Perform other duties as assigned such as general labor or operator duties when Telehandler duties are experiencing downtime.




    Education & Experience:




    • Job requirements are listed below:

      • 2-5 years Telehandler/Zoom Boom experience

      • Valid Class 5 Driver’s License is required

      • Clean 5-year Driver Abstract obtained within 30 days of starting work is required

      • CSO (Common Safety Orientation) certificate is required


      • WHMIS 2015 Certification is required

      • Zoom Boom/Telehandler ticket recognized by Energy Safety Canada is required

      • Ability to lift 50 pounds or more

      • Safety conscious attitude

      • Must be willing to work in fluctuating climates (hot, cold, wet) and environmental conditions

      • Must be comfortable working in close proximity to water

      • Ability to pass a Drug and Alcohol test and Fit for Duty test

        • Applicants are required to be clean shaven for testing and beyond



      • All applicants must have the ability to speak, read and write fluently in English

      • All applicants must be legally eligible to work in Canada

      • The following would be an asset to your application:

        • Crane Ticket is an asset

        • Transportation of Dangerous Goods (TDG) Certification is an asset

        • Rigging Certification is an asset

        • OSSA Confined Space Entry and Monitor Certification is an asset

        • First Aid Certification is an asset

        • H2S Alive Certification is an asset
